Ísafjörður boasts a surprisingly robust arts scene for its size. The legendary "Aldrei fór ég suður" (Never Went South) music festival is a highlight, attracting Icelandic and international artists. This free rock festival takes place during Easter weekend. It transforms the town into a buzzing hub of musical energy. Another significant event is the "Við Djúpið" classical music festival. It showcases high-caliber performances in intimate settings. Art exhibitions frequently pop up in local galleries and community spaces. These events offer a glimpse into the creative spirit of the Westfjords. Look for workshops and open studio days where you can meet local artists. The cultural calendar also includes theatre performances and film screenings throughout the year. Exploring where to find Ísafjörður art can be a rewarding experience. Given its stunning natural surroundings, Ísafjörður is a paradise for outdoor enthusiasts. 2025 will see several exciting sporting events. The Fossavatn Ski Marathon draws participants from around the world. It is one of Iceland's most prestigious cross-country skiing races. Summer months bring trail running competitions and cycling events through picturesque landscapes. Kayaking races and rowing regattas also take place in the fjord.
